Pull access :: Used to describe an optional resource. Some learners may not need it, others might be glad of it. This popup is in itself an example of pull access.
Micromasteries :: Discrete skills that are worth learning in their own right. Three examples could be: tying a bowline to make a loop in a rope; square breathing to calm the nerves; and password management to save time and frustration..
